Measles Outbreak in Pennsylvania: A Wake-Up Call for Vaccination

Recent measles-related deaths in Pennsylvania underscore the critical necessity for public vaccinations, as two unvaccinated individuals tragically lost their lives. This incident marks a significant public health concern, emphasizing the urgency for increased vaccination efforts.

Key Takeaways

  • Two unvaccinated individuals in Pennsylvania died from measles.
  • This is the first measles-related death in Pennsylvania in 35 years.
  • The outbreak raises alarms about vaccination rates in the state.
  • Officials emphasize the need for public awareness on vaccinations.
  • Historical data shows a decline in measles cases linked to vaccination efforts.

The Severity of the Outbreak

The recent measles outbreak in Pennsylvania has brought serious concerns to the forefront of public health discussions. The deaths of two unvaccinated individuals serve as a grim reminder of the potential consequences of declining vaccination rates. Health officials have reported that this is the first occurrence of measles-related deaths in the state in over three decades, signaling a worrisome trend.

As cases of measles begin to resurface, the implications extend beyond individual health to the community at large. Vaccination not only protects individuals but also fosters herd immunity, which is critical in preventing outbreaks. In recent years, certain regions, particularly in the United States, have witnessed a decline in vaccination uptake, leading to a rise in preventable diseases.

The Role of Vaccination

Vaccination is a proven method for controlling the spread of infectious diseases. Measles, which is highly contagious, can easily spread in communities with low vaccination rates.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) indicates that a measles vaccination rate of 95% or higher is essential to achieving herd immunity. The deaths in Pennsylvania highlight the urgent need to raise awareness about the efficacy and safety of vaccines.

Public Response and Health Initiatives

In light of this outbreak, Pennsylvania health officials are ramping up efforts to promote vaccination. Public health campaigns are being initiated to educate the public regarding the importance of measles vaccines. The focus will be on reaching communities that have historically shown hesitancy towards vaccinations.

Additionally, local health departments are strategizing outreach programs in schools and community centers, particularly in areas with lower vaccination rates. By integrating educational materials and discussions, health officials aim to dispel myths and misinformation about vaccines.

Measles Vaccination and Its Importance

The measles vaccine has been around since the 1960s, proving highly effective in reducing the incidence of the disease. With a success rate of over 90%, it’s critical for parents and guardians to understand the vaccine's role in protecting not just their children but also the broader community.

Conclusion

The recent measles deaths in Pennsylvania serve as a stark reminder of the consequences of neglecting vaccination. As communities begin to reopen and interact more after extended lockdowns, the resurgence of diseases like measles poses significant health risks. It is imperative for individuals and communities to recommit to vaccination. By understanding the facts and participating in vaccination programs, we can work towards preventing future outbreaks and protecting public health.
